Eat Like a Local: Must-Try Foods in May, Laos

Lao cuisine is a delightful blend of flavours. Don't miss out on trying khao soi (a coconut curry noodle soup), laap (a spicy minced meat salad), and sticky rice (a staple in Lao cuisine). Venture beyond the tourist restaurants and explore local eateries for the most authentic culinary experiences.
